Naturstilleben mit Trauben, Blumen und Beeren in einer Wanli-Schale: eine Feier der vergänglichen Natur. Diese reproduction des Naturstillebens, in dem saftige Trauben, leuchtende Blumen und zarte Beeren miteinander verschmelzen, vermittelt eine Atmosphäre von Gelassenheit und flüchtiger Schönheit. Die lebendigen Farben, die von tiefem Grün bis zu strahlendem Rot reichen, fangen das Licht auf eine fast lebendige Weise ein. Die Technik des Künstlers, die feine Details und subtile Schatten verwendet, schafft eine Illusion von Tiefe und Textur. Jedes Element der Komposition ist sorgfältig angeordnet und lädt den Betrachter ein, die Fülle der Natur zu bewundern, während gleichzeitig die Zerbrechlichkeit des Lebens betont wird. Isaak Soreau: ein Meister des Naturstillebens im 17. Jahrhundert. Isaak Soreau, niederländischer Maler des 17. Jahrhunderts, ist bekannt für seine Werke des Naturstillebens, die das Wesen des täglichen Lebens einfangen. Beeinflusst vom Barockstil, verstand Soreau, Realismus und Poesie in seinen Kompositionen zu vereinen. Seine Karriere blühte zu einer Zeit auf, in der das Naturstilleben zu einem bedeutenden künstlerischen Genre wurde, das sowohl den materiellen Reichtum als auch die Eitelkeit des Lebens widerspiegelt. Soreaus Werke, oft geprägt von einer minutiösen Detailgenauigkeit, zeugen von seiner Fähigkeit, flüchtige Momente durch Malerei zu verewigen. Eine dekorative Anschaffung mit vielfältigen Vorzügen.
